The information presents a five-year view of several financial metrics, including common equity market value, total equity, total equity and debt, and enterprise value. Overall, enterprise value exhibits fluctuations over the period, with a general trend towards volatility.

Enterprise Value Trend
Enterprise value decreased from US$267.386 billion in 2021 to US$264.687 billion in 2023, representing a cumulative decline of approximately 0.97%. A more substantial decrease was observed in 2024, falling to US$231.967 billion. However, the most recent year, 2025, shows a recovery to US$262.352 billion, though it remains below the 2021 level.
Equity Components
Common equity (market value) mirrored the enterprise value trend, initially increasing from US$232.932 billion in 2021 to US$237.961 billion in 2022, before declining to US$230.451 billion in 2023 and a significant drop to US$196.797 billion in 2024. A rebound to US$222.559 billion is noted in 2025.
Total equity followed a similar pattern, with a peak of US$238.085 billion in 2022 and a low of US$196.927 billion in 2024, recovering to US$222.700 billion in 2025.
Debt Influence
Total equity and debt generally increased from US$273.374 billion in 2021 to US$277.156 billion in 2022, then decreased to US$274.690 billion in 2023. A more pronounced decrease occurred in 2024, reaching US$241.233 billion, followed by an increase to US$271.882 billion in 2025. The fluctuations in total equity and debt appear to partially offset changes in equity market value, influencing the enterprise value.

The largest percentage decrease in enterprise value occurred between 2023 and 2024. The recovery observed in 2025 suggests a potential stabilization, but further monitoring is warranted to confirm a sustained upward trend. The interplay between equity components and debt levels appears to be a key driver of the observed enterprise value movements.
